That is normal, I did a pull to 75mph in the 4 demo and ordered the 4S on the spot (they did not have 4S demo, I found the 4 tame).
Official stats below for 0-200 with LC unfortunately so far off reality but still solid comparison between the models:
4 -> 19
4S -> 14.3
Turbo -> 11.7
No difference in power between normal & sport, normal is rwd, sport is awd, sharper throttle response & lower suspension but when you’re foot to the floor you’re 100% throttle and using both motors.
